PRELIMINARY
DS3134
Chateau – Channelized T1 And
E1 And HDLC Controller
www.dalsemi.com
FEATURES
256 Channel HDLC Controller that Supports
up to 64 T1 or E1 Lines or Two T3 Lines
256 Independent bi-directional HDLC
channels
16 physical ports (16 Tx & 16 Rx) that can
be configured as either channelized or
unchannelized
Two fast (52 Mbps) ports/other ports capable
of speeds up to 10 Mbps (unchannelized)
Channelized Ports 0 to 15 handle one, two or
four T1 or E1 lines
Supports up to 64 T1 or E1 data streams
Per channel DS0 loopbacks in both direction
Support transparent Mode
V.54 loopback code detector
Onboard Bit Error Rate Tester (BERT) with
auto error insertion capability
BERT function can be assigned to any
HDLC channel or any port
104 Mbps full duplex throughput
Large 16 kbits FIFO in both receive and
transmit directions
Efficient scatter / gather DMA
Receive data packets are Time stamped
Transmit packet priority setting
Local bus allows for PCI bridging or local
access
Intel or Motorola bus signals supported
25 MHz to 33 MHz 32-bit PCI (V2.1)
backplane interface
3.3V low power CMOS with 5V tolerant I/O
JTAG support IEEE 1149.1
256 Lead Plastic BGA (27 mm x 27 mm)
DESCRIPTION
The DS3134 Chateau device is a 256-channel HDLC controller. The DS3134 is capable of handling up to
64 T1 or E1 data streams or 2 T3 data streams. Each of the 16 physical ports can handle one, two or four
T1 or E1 data streams. The Chateau consists of the following blocks:
